Anyone else have issues with the temperature microchips? by Snakes_for_life in VetTech

[–]bbumblebug 9 points10 points  (0 children)

Yeah those are notoriously untrustworthy. If you get a number that seems off always double check with at least an aural temp but obviously rectal is most accurate

How do I bathe when warm shower or warm (almost) cold bath sends me into spasms when I get out? by dnegvesk in ChronicPain

[–]bbumblebug 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Yes a shower chair is your best option if its the hard tub bottom hurting you. You can also get cushy mats for your bathtub. If it is the temperature shift from warm water to room temp that is causing you to spasm, maybe try using a space heater in your bathroom or getting a robe to keep you warm while you dry off

What purchase under $30 solved a problem you didn’t realize was draining you? by Right_Process in AskReddit

[–]bbumblebug 2 points3 points  (0 children)

One of those old fashion push brooms. I realized I always avoided vacuuming because it has so many steps involved (grabbing the vacuum from where its stored and bringing it to where you need to clean, unwrapping the cord, plugging it in, then doing all of that in reverse) and using a push broom is much easier and lighter. I still have my vacuum because it is better for certain messes, but my floors have been much cleaner because I can use my broom easier
